Transaction 517c4c35f35acbb0339c7e46dfdb32b811bfda0af0b84281127a92ef4f460da0

3 Input
2 Outputs
  • 517c4c35f35acbb0339c7e46dfdb32b811bfda0af0b84281127a92ef4f460da0:0
  • value  58049508
    address  1KKyFCvUHyagQsj7vJH22YNz4yRkiCNikq
  • 517c4c35f35acbb0339c7e46dfdb32b811bfda0af0b84281127a92ef4f460da0:1
  • value  18492
    address  1K7LLxUtgfdotnT28Ye9kxYzRMhDF6bTQT